Web7 de jun. de 2024 · Together, pick out something that your child can bring to school that can remind them of that: a small stuffed animal, a photo, or even a smiley face drawn on their hand. Called a "transitional object" by child psychology experts, these familiar items ease separation anxiety and help your child feel closer to you when you are absent. 4

WebKeep any goodbyes short. Reassure your child that you’ll be back at a specific time. Try to follow through on this. Be consistent to help your child feel confident that you’ll return.
